Over the last few years a number of wrestlers have parted ways with WWE and joined AEW. Former WWE World Heavyweight Champion Jake Hager happens to be one of them and fans can often see him featured on AEW TV with the Jericho Appreciation Society.

Recently Hager appeared on Story Time with Dutch Mantell and he discussed the topic of unions in professional wrestling. According to Jake Hager wrestlers were not allowed to talk about their contracts, or the idea of a union unless they wanted to get blacklisted from the company.

“While I was there (in WWE), that was like the four-letter word. Don’t talk about your contracts, and don’t talk about anything having to do with a union, otherwise, you’ll get blacklisted. I saw it happen. Someone…I can’t remember exactly, but they were complaining about something and they were talking about how we should all get together and get some power and I’m like, ‘It’s not that company.’ The biggest things with those WWE contracts are, they can cancel them anytime, and they’ve proven that they will, so what does it all really mean if you can’t rely on it? You sign your life away.”

“It proves the point that back then, and even when I was there, we didn’t have any options. There was only one game in town. Now we have AEW, so hopefully, the competition makes everything better for the performers. I think you will see that with contracts because you have more options and even overseas, they’re paying a little better.”
